First Soccer Coaching Tips – Teaching Philosophy Of The Game

Engrafting the game philosophy is very influential in the style of the games. We can see for many countries in South America playing with their individual techniques, tricks, “crafty”. Compare with European countries, especially for the North section, they play with solid, safety first, very careful, direct pass. Engrafting the game philosophy depends on the type of skill that players have. If the players are good in individual skills, Engraft the game style with full force of tricky play, a lot of runs with the ball. If the players have less individual skills, use a good passing game, team cooperation, and solid defense.

Third Soccer Coaching Tips – Be A Role Model

The players will need a role model to be a good example for them, and coach is which can be it. Before you train a team, then you must be willing to be role model for players. Always calm in training players and show warm feeling to them, and give them an intimacy so that there is no distance between players and coaches so that players can easily absorb the lesson from coach.
